- Abstract:
- Background. For the experienced emergency physician as well as for the beginner, pre-clinical treatment of altered mental staus can be very challenging because of the heterogeneity of its causes. Results. Contrary to the diagnostic possibilities of an emergency department, many diagnostic tools are not available under pre-clinical conditions. After initial assessment of immediate threats by using the ABCDE approach, it is important to identify those pathologies where the patient would profit from further immediate and specific pre-clinical treatment. Situations where a specific hospital has to be chosen (24-h CT scan availability, stroke unit, neurosurgery department) must also be recognized. Objective. The authors give a compact and structured summary about relevant key points in the treatment of nontrauma-associated altered mental status. Basic and advanced life support is assumed in each case and not covered by this article.
